**Ripple Vs SEC Lawsuit: Judge Grants SEC’s Deadline Extension Request**

In a significant development in the ongoing legal battle between Ripple Labs and the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), the judge has signed an order relating to the SEC’s request to extend deadlines for remedies-related briefing, as well as opposition to briefing and reply.

**Court’s Verdict on SEC’s Deadline Extension Request**

The judge has granted the U.S. SEC’s motion to modify the deadlines for remedies-related briefing, Ripple’s opposition to brief, and the SEC’s reply to Ripple’s opposition, according to a court filing. This means that the deadlines for various submissions have been extended.

The SEC had requested an extension for filing its remedies-related opening brief from March 13 to March 22, 2024. Additionally, Ripple was given an extension for filing its opposition brief from April 12 to April 22, and the SEC was given an extension for filing its reply from April 29 to May 6.

The lawsuit has been extended by a week in order to give the SEC enough time to review remedies-related discovery documents submitted by Ripple. Previously, Magistrate Judge Netburn had granted Ripple’s request to delay remedies-related discovery requirements by a week, which included providing detailed financial statements and information about post-complaint XRP institutional sales.

In response to the SEC’s arguments on investment contracts, pro-XRP lawyer Bill Morgan stated that there is a significant weakness in the SEC’s interpretation of investment contracts as applied to crypto assets. He argued that there is no limiting principle and no reason for an overly broad application of the Howey principles just because an asset class is different from any other before.
